Output edea80b6275ed2074f64502c98a2f78bb52aec8a97b9f72d429c26a04d7b7ec6:110

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c41eae80f178a43dfebde43b709eb1c2ccab97992b76af53364bc2f04e53a148
address
bc1pcs02aq830zjrml4ausahp843ctx2h9ue9dm275ekf0p0qnjn59yqs7xwue
transaction
edea80b6275ed2074f64502c98a2f78bb52aec8a97b9f72d429c26a04d7b7ec6
confirmations
12929
spent
true